The mixed number 27 104/125 written as an improper fraction is 3479/125
To turn the mixed number 27 104/125 into an improper fraction, use these simple steps:
First, multiply the whole number by the denominator of the fractional part: 27 × 125 = 3375.
After that, add the result to the numerator of the fractional part: 3375 + 104 = 3479.
Next, Write the sum of the previous step on the original denominator: 3479/125.
This means that 27 104/125, as an improper fraction, equals 3479/125.
